Overview

Pharmacy Benefits Management (PBM) covers companies and platforms managing prescription-drug benefits for health-plan sponsors — formulary design, negotiation, rebates, and claims adjudication. The market is a tight oligopoly: CVS Caremark, Express Scripts (Cigna), and OptumRx (UnitedHealth) control the vast majority, each vertically integrated with a major insurer.

PBMs sit at the center of drug-pricing flows, and their rebate and spread-pricing models have drawn intense FTC, Congressional, and state scrutiny and reform proposals. Reported revenue is large because drug costs flow through PBMs; the value-add is the management spread and rebate economics.

Market snapshot

Market size
~$284B
Growth
~9.9%CAGR (2017–22, nominal)
Companies
~7,700
FragmentationConsolidated

U.S. Census Bureau 2022 CBP/Economic Census, NAICS 524292 (Pharmacy Benefit Management & Other TPA); revenue largely reflects drug-cost pass-through, not value-add.

Business model & economics

Revenue model
Management fees, rebates, and spread on drug flows
Recurring revenue
High — multi-year benefit-management contracts
EBITDA margin
Thin on gross flows; concentrated in rebate/spread economics
Capex intensity
Low
  • Tight oligopoly vertically integrated with insurers.
  • At the center of drug-pricing flows.
  • Rebate/spread models under intense regulatory scrutiny.
